WebAug 18, 2024 · Conclusion. Not all bats migrate, but those that do usually migrate between September and November every year. Most bats will return north to their prior roost in March or April, while others may decide to remain in climates that are warm year-round. Female bats may migrate at any time of year to find an ideal location for child-rearing. WebOct 26, 2016 · They rarely hang from the ceiling in an attic during the winter because it is too cold. Bats can leave droppings called guano all over an attic. The smell can be overpowering, and it can also spread diseases. Some bats carry rabies, which can be spread if a bat bites someone. WebAug 16, 2024 · A bat’s normal heart rate is 200 to 300 beats per minute. Bats in hibernation may go many minutes without needing to breathe. Bats also go into hibernation mode, or torpor, when there’s an extreme cold snap outside of the winter months. They find a good roosting area and slow down their metabolism.
